TRIVIA (5)
Sound
Features digitized title soundtrack at 10.2KHz
Music written with TCB Tracker

Hardware
Supports STe palette
Graphics
Features up to 57 colours on-screen simultaneously (in-game) on STe
Features up to 37 colours on-screen simultaneously (in-game) on ST

Charts
Top UK ST charts position: 1 (8/1991)
Months on charts: 6 between 7/1991 - 12/1991

Releases
The Atari ST version was released first on the 16 bit market in Europe. Published later for other 16 bit systems.
Source: Research of over 16700 software reviews from UK computer magazines between 1985 and 1996.
